How Donset 8mg Tablet MD works:
Donset 8mg Tablets are prescribed to prevent nausea and vomiting. This antiemetic medication functions by inhibiting serotonin, a neurotransmitter in the brain that triggers these symptoms, particularly in patients undergoing chemotherapy or post-surgery recovery.

What if you forget to take Donset 8mg Tablet MD :
Should you forget a Donset 8mg Tablet MD dose, take it immediately. However,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ing schedule. Never take a double dose.
